Founder Interview #12 - Ahmad Mukoshy

Ahmad Mukoshy (@mukoshy) is a 22 year old entrepreneur living in Nigeria. He’s currently working on hosting company AimTech and url shortener yrn.me.

Q: What was your first startup and how old were you?
My first startup was a hosting company, http://aimtechng.com providing web hosting to Nigerian web site owners since 2007 and I started Aimtech when I was 17.

Q: How have you used your first experiences to improve your future work?
Everything I do now is a successor of my past experience and I believe what the future will also be based on my present experience. Experience is the best teacher they said and shapes the way forward.

In the past I tried building social networks then I found out that, it requires a lot of capital and takes longer time to be profitable with more efforts than usual. So, I switched to building products/tools instead, which will allow me to start making income almost immediately and that way, if my idea is not good, I get to know it from client 1.
Q: When did you first realize you had an itch to start your own companies?
That was after my high school, when I built my own personal website and friends started asking me for help to make theirs too. I figured I could make it a business and so I started aimtechng.com.
After a couple of months, it went main stream and I starting having clients from more states around Nigeria, it all exploded at once, like they were waiting for a web host. Of course, there were not very many web hosts in Nigeria at that time.

Q: What are you currently working on?
I am still working on the web hosting company and a url shortner that I built recently. There are a few more things that I will be experimenting soon too.

Q: What advice have you been given that has stuck with you the most?
Stay focused and be persistent at it. The most powerful warriors are Patience and Time; theirs is nothing they can’t conquer.

Q: Do you feel at a disadvantage living outside of the United States?
No, not that much. Although I have had difficulties with payment options, PayPal and most payment gateways were not accepting Nigerians. I had to let go on a lot of my creative ideas due to difficulties on the billing.

I also had insufficient Internet access, imagine 15kbps in this age.
